Load Speed Performance

Load speed refers to how quickly apps and web pages open and become usable. It is influenced by hardware specifications, software optimization, and network connectivity.

Hardware Specifications

The Pixel 7 is equipped with Google’s Tensor chip, which provides efficient performance tailored for AI tasks. It has 8GB of RAM, ensuring smooth multitasking. The Galaxy S23 features the Snapdragon 8 Gen 2 or Exynos 2200, depending on the region, with up to 12GB of RAM, offering robust performance for demanding applications.

Software Optimization

Google’s clean Android interface on the Pixel 7 allows for quick app launches and minimal bloat, contributing to faster load times. Samsung’s One UI, layered over Android, offers additional features but can sometimes introduce slight delays in app loading, especially with heavy multitasking.

Responsiveness in Daily Use

Responsiveness measures how well a device reacts to user inputs, such as taps, swipes, and typing. A highly responsive device provides a smooth and seamless user experience.

Touch Response and Animation

The Pixel 7 offers immediate touch response with fluid animations, thanks to its optimized software and hardware integration. Samsung devices also deliver excellent responsiveness, with high refresh rate screens (up to 120Hz) that make scrolling and animations appear smooth.

Multitasking and App Switching

Both devices excel in multitasking. The Pixel 7’s efficient hardware ensures quick app switching, while Samsung’s larger RAM and multitasking features like split-screen enhance responsiveness for power users.
